Не удается найти mosConfig_absolute_path в файле configuration.php

Я пытаюсь переместить свой веб-сайт Joomla1 с локального хоста на свой домен bluehost.com. Для тестирования я создал подкаталог на своем домене для тестирования и переместил все мои файлы Joomla! файлы к этому. Я создал этот подкаталог в папке public_html.

Я использую разные меню на первой странице (пользовательская страница) и на остальных страницах. Моя проблема в том, что пункты меню на главной странице ищут страницы в подкаталоге с именем joomla вместо поиска страниц в моем подкаталоге (тестирование)

Основываясь на предложениях некоторых веб-сайтов, я подумал, что изменение mosConfig_absolute_path поможет, но мой файл configuration.php в подкаталоге testing не имеет свойства с именем mosConfig_absolute_path. Я не сталкиваюсь с этой проблемой ни в одном из пунктов меню на других страницах.

Может кто-нибудь, пожалуйста, помогите мне с этой проблемой и как я должен ее преодолеть. Спасибо.


person lostInTransit    schedule 27.02.2009    source источник


Ответы (1)


Переменная, о которой вы говорите, это $mosConfig_absolute_path, а не $msConfig_absolute_path. Вам также потребуется сбросить $mosConfig_live_site.

Кроме того, переход на Joomla! 1.5 позволит полностью избежать этой проблемы; он автоматически определяет ваш базовый путь и URL.

person jlleblanc    schedule 27.02.2009
comment
Спасибо. Позже я узнал, что это был mosConfig, но я его тоже не вижу. И базовый путь не распознается. Если вы видите вопрос, ссылки меню на первой странице ведут не туда. - person lostInTransit; 28.02.2009
comment
Вы пробовали добавить $mosConfig_live_site в configuration.php? Есть ли вообще в этом файле переменные $mosConfig? - person jlleblanc; 02.03.2009